AV Mazzega Horn Chandelier

Materials: Chromed metal frame (iron), curved slats and parts. Turned wood tops. Chrome chain & canopy. White, amber and clear crystal hand blown Murano glass horn style lampshades. 6 Bakelite E14 socket.

Chain Length: 50 cm / 19.68”

Height: 60 cm / 23.62”

Width: ∅ 64 cm / 25.19”

Electricity: 6 bulbs E14, 6 x 40 watt maximum, 110/220 volt.
Any type of light bulb can be used, not a specific one preferred.

Period: 1960s, 1970s – Mid-Century Modern.

Designer: Gianni Bruno Mazzega – attributed.

Manufacturer: AV Mazzega, Murano, Italy – attributed.

Other versions: This AV Mazzega horn chandelier exists in several versions. Also wall lamps and table lamps were made with this type of glass.

AV Mazzega was founded in 1946 by Angelo Vittorio Mazzega. In 1950 his son Gianni Bruno Mazzega started working in the family’s glass factory. Gianni Bruno Mazzega is responsible for the creation of many beautiful lamps, such this one.

Today, under the watchful eye of Andrea Mazzega, grandson of Angelo Vittorio, the company works together with high-level international designers. Andrea is the president of the company since 2000. Today the company is named Mazzega 1946.

Designers that worked for AV Mazzega – Mazzega 1946 are among others: Carlo NasonAldo Nason, Christophe Pillet, Michele De Lucchi, Giovanni Barbato, Paolo Piva, Sam Baron, Gasmi Chafik, Oriano Favaretto and Riccardo Giovanetti.
